How to Keep Your Guests at the Table

I LOVE to throw dinner parties...even in the tiny condo. Whether I serve a several course meal or something that I've faked (yo, I aint to proud to admit that I've served Shake N Bake), I always enjoy having friends gather around my table.

I have conversation cards that usually come out after the main course is served, while my guests and I are enjoying a bottle of wine and waiting for dessert. They are the MOST fun and I highly recommend them! But I digress.

Sometimes, my guests adjourn to the living room to sit on the couches or the floor and while that doesn't bother me, I THINK I know why now...

MY CHAIRS WERE TOO HARD.

Enter my latest home investment...my NEW DINING ROOM FURNITURE. You can't tell that I'm excited at all, can you?!?!

A few weeks back, I found the perfect chairs for my dining room, then last week I found my table. I didn't go with the most expensive table, but I did find one that I like A LOT and know that if I want to paint and distress it down the road, it won't be the end of the world. (Sounds like the inner workings of a sicko DIYer's brain, no?!)

I've spent some time this week just sitting in my chairs. They are cozy...and now I know that my guests will want to stay at the table with me, enjoying not only good food, but good conversation and friendship, too.

If you have a similar problem and can't necessarily afford new chairs now, I encourage you to look at seat cushions or even to make some. There are some great DIY options out there, so don't let anything keep you from creating a comfortable dining experience for you and your friends!
